A specialized pneumatic covering for the wheels of lawn and garden machinery is engineered with a distinct focus on preserving delicate ground surfaces while providing adequate grip.
This type of product features a unique tread pattern and a specific profile designed to minimize compaction and tearing of grass, making it ideal for groundskeeping applications.
For instance, a commercial landscaping company might equip its fleet of zero-turn mowers with these tires to ensure a pristine finish on high-end residential lawns.
Similarly, a homeowner with a large garden tractor would use them to navigate their property without leaving ruts or damaging the turf during frequent use.
The core principle behind this design is balancing traction with surface protection.
Unlike agricultural or industrial tires that have deep, aggressive lugs for maximum grip in loose soil, these turf-specific models utilize a series of interconnected blocks or a shallow, s-shaped pattern.
This configuration distributes the vehicle’s weight over a wider area, preventing the concentrated pressure that leads to soil compaction and root damage.
The shoulder of the tire is often rounded, a critical feature that allows for smooth, scuff-free turns, which is particularly important for maintaining the aesthetic quality of manicured lawns and golf courses.

The Carlisle Turf Trac R/S represents a specific and highly regarded solution within the specialty tire market, designed explicitly for lawn and garden equipment.
Manufactured by The Carlstar Group, a company with a long-standing reputation for quality and innovation, this tire model is engineered to meet the demanding requirements of both residential and commercial grounds care.
It is frequently chosen as an original equipment manufacturer (OEM) part for new mowers and tractors, a testament to its reliability and performance.
The design philosophy centers on delivering effective traction and durability without compromising the health and appearance of the turf it operates on.
A defining characteristic of this particular model is its distinctive tread pattern, which is the source of the “Turf Trac” name.
The tread consists of chevron-style, block-like segments that are arranged to provide consistent grip in multiple directions, whether moving forward, reversing, or traversing a slope.
This design ensures that the equipment operator maintains control and stability, which is essential for safety and precision.

The depth and spacing of the tread blocks are carefully calibrated to offer sufficient traction on wet grass or uneven ground while being shallow enough to prevent digging into and damaging the turf’s sensitive root structure.
The “R/S” in the product name stands for “Round Shoulder,” a crucial design element for turf preservation.
This rounded profile at the edge of the tire minimizes the risk of scuffing or tearing the grass during sharp turns, a common issue with square-shouldered tires.
When a mower or tractor turns, the outer edge of the tire experiences significant pressure, and a rounded design allows it to roll smoothly over the surface rather than gouging it.
This feature is especially valued by professional landscapers and golf course superintendents who must maintain flawless, unblemished turf surfaces for their clients and patrons.
Durability is another cornerstone of the Turf Trac R/S design, achieved through the use of a robust rubber compound and sturdy internal construction.
These tires are built to withstand the typical hazards encountered in lawn care environments, such as small rocks, sticks, and the occasional curb impact.
The compound is formulated for a long wear life, resisting abrasion and degradation from sun exposure and common lawn chemicals.
This focus on longevity ensures that users get a reliable return on their investment, with less frequent need for replacements and reduced equipment downtime.
Versatility is a key advantage, as this tire is suitable for a wide array of equipment beyond just lawnmowers.
It is commonly fitted on garden tractors, utility carts, spreaders, and other compact vehicles used in landscaping, property maintenance, and recreational settings like golf courses.
Its balanced performance characteristics make it an excellent all-around choice for applications where the primary operational surface is grass.
The availability of numerous sizes further enhances its adaptability, allowing it to be fitted to a vast range of machinery from various manufacturers.
Proper inflation is critical to unlocking the full performance potential of the Turf Trac R/S.
Operating the tire at the manufacturer-recommended air pressure ensures that the tread makes optimal contact with the ground, providing the intended balance of traction and turf protection.
Under-inflation can lead to excessive sidewall flex and uneven wear, while over-inflation can cause the tire to become too rigid, reducing the contact patch and increasing the risk of turf damage.
Regular pressure checks are a simple but vital maintenance step for maximizing the tire’s lifespan and effectiveness.
When compared to other turf tire options, the Turf Trac R/S occupies a middle ground that makes it highly popular.
It offers significantly more traction than a smooth or ribbed tire, which might slip on wet or sloped terrain, but is far gentler than an aggressive lug tire (like an ATV or agricultural tire) that would aggressively tear up a lawn.
This makes it the ideal choice for general-purpose mowing and utility work on standard turf. Its design represents a carefully engineered compromise that serves the majority of lawn care needs exceptionally well.
The selection process for this tire involves matching the size specifications printed on the sidewall with the requirements of the equipment.
These numbers typically indicate the tire’s height, width, and the diameter of the rim it is designed to fit.
Choosing the correct size is non-negotiable for ensuring proper clearance, stability, and overall safe operation of the machine.
Consumers and professionals can easily find these specifications in their equipment’s owner’s manual or on the sidewall of the existing tires.
Furthermore, the tire’s classification as a Non-Highway Service (NHS) product is an important distinction. This designation means it is not legally or safely designed for use on public roads or at high speeds.
The construction and materials are optimized for the lower speeds and specific load requirements of lawn and garden machinery.
Adhering to this limitation is crucial for operator safety and for preventing premature tire failure that could result from the stresses of on-road use.

Broader Context of Specialty Turf Tires
The development of specialized tires for lawn and garden equipment marks a significant evolution from early, more generic solutions.
Initially, small equipment often used scaled-down versions of agricultural or industrial tires, which were ill-suited for delicate turf.
The rise of the commercial landscaping industry and the demand for pristine residential lawns drove innovation, leading to the creation of dedicated turf-specific designs.
Manufacturers began extensive research into tread patterns, rubber compounds, and tire profiles that could provide necessary traction without causing the compaction and tearing associated with more aggressive models.
The science behind tread design is a complex field that balances multiple competing requirements. For turf tires, the primary goal is to create friction against grass and soil without a destructive shearing action.
The block patterns and sipes (small slits) on tires like the Turf Trac R/S are engineered to grip grass blades and the top layer of soil for traction, while the wide, flat profile distributes weight to prevent deep impressions.
This contrasts sharply with mud tires, which are designed to paddle through and eject loose material, an action that would be catastrophic for a well-maintained lawn.
Understanding ply ratings and load indexes is crucial for the safe and effective use of any non-highway tire.
The ply rating is a legacy measurement of a tire’s strength, originally referring to the number of cotton layers in its casing.
Today, it serves as an index of toughness and load capacity, even with modern materials.
A higher ply rating indicates a stronger tire capable of holding more air pressure and supporting a heavier load, making it essential to match this rating to the equipment’s operational weight.
The shape of a tire’s shoulder has a direct impact on the handling and performance of lawn equipment. A square shoulder provides a larger contact patch and can offer more stability on flat, straight runs.
However, it is notoriously harsh on turf during turns.
The rounded shoulder, as seen on the Turf Trac R/S, is a deliberate design choice that prioritizes turf health and maneuverability over absolute lateral grip, which is a fitting compromise for the intended application of groundskeeping.
Effective maintenance practices are fundamental to maximizing the return on investment in quality turf tires. Beyond checking for damage and maintaining air pressure, proper storage during the off-season plays a vital role.
Storing equipment in a cool, dry place away from direct sunlight and ozone sources (like electric motors) prevents the rubber from drying out and cracking.
If storing tires unmounted, they should be stacked flat to avoid creating flat spots or distorting their shape.
The distinction between tubeless and tube-type tires is another important consideration in the turf care sector.
Tubeless tires, which are common today, form an airtight seal directly with the wheel rim, offering better heat dissipation and a slower loss of air in the event of a minor puncture.
Tube-type tires, while less common on new equipment, use a separate inner tube to hold air and can sometimes be a solution for older or slightly damaged rims that can no longer hold a perfect seal.
As environmental awareness grows, the impact of tire manufacturing and disposal in the landscaping industry is receiving more attention. Manufacturers are exploring more sustainable materials and production processes.
Furthermore, responsible disposal through recycling programs is becoming more prevalent. These programs shred old tires and repurpose the rubber for use in products like playground surfaces, asphalt, and molded goods, reducing the burden on landfills.
The right tire selection can also have an indirect but noticeable effect on operational efficiency and operator comfort.
Tires that provide good traction without slipping reduce wasted energy, potentially leading to modest fuel savings over the life of the machine.
Additionally, a well-designed tire with appropriate sidewall flex can absorb some of the vibrations from uneven terrain, contributing to a smoother ride and reducing operator fatigue during long hours of work.

Frequently Asked Questions
John asks: “I have a small utility ATV that I use around my property, mostly on grass but sometimes on dirt paths. Can I use the Carlisle Turf Trac R/S on it?”
Professional’s Answer: “Hello John, that’s a great question. While the Turf Trac R/S is excellent for turf, it is not recommended for an ATV.
These tires carry a Non-Highway Service (NHS) rating and are designed for the lower speeds of lawn equipment.
ATVs often operate at higher speeds and on more varied, aggressive terrain than these tires are built for.
For your use, you would be much safer and better served by a tire specifically designed for ATVs, which will have the appropriate speed rating and a more durable construction for path and trail use.”
